About the role

The South Dakota Department of Labor and Regulation Administrative Services Division is seeking a highly motivated and detail-oriented Operational Resources Specialist to join our team in Pierre, SD. This position manages property operations across multiple facilities around the state, ensures effective and efficient use of resources, and supports the Department’s mission. This position also coordinates all purchases in DLR.

Responsibilities

  • Manage property operations for DLR facilities, including facility operations, contract management, and vendor relations.
  • Identify systemic property issues and recommend solutions to leadership.
  • Coordinate maintenance, repairs, upgrades, and relocation of staff and assets across offices.
  • Lead facility-related projects, including timelines, vendor coordination, and issue resolution.
  • Develop and enforce operational policies and procedures affecting multiple divisions, ensuring compliance with state standards.
  • Conduct annual ADA compliance reviews.
  • Oversee purchasing, inventory management, asset verification, and technology lifecycle processes.
  • Conduct cost-benefit analyses when making expensive decisions, consulting with leadership as needed.
  • Collaborate with building designees, division accountants, and other state agencies on leases.
